Output 31e34eb4aba1bf82669500718a86e31d89c22ec928b6f9fb43dd9077a827f3de:0

value
9963
script pubkey
OP_0 OP_PUSHBYTES_20 bae32f560a61f5affc2ce623ea2974a13581295a
address
bc1qht3j74s2v866llpvuc3752t55y6cz226x295xs
transaction
31e34eb4aba1bf82669500718a86e31d89c22ec928b6f9fb43dd9077a827f3de
spent
true